Transaction 81a5080ea07effe8533135ce19a41463b334a64a7938c0a819ca6b2502d83178
1 Input
1 Output
-
81a5080ea07effe8533135ce19a41463b334a64a7938c0a819ca6b2502d83178:0
- value
- 42191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1ee4fff4adaad7082f1efc247e587e785c2ccaa OP_EQUAL
- address
- 3KNRposvzSjaXzrJztMPR3RzDVjhmkeJ6J